Abstract
BACKGROUND Persistent left superior vena cava (PLSVC) is the most common variant of systemic venous drainage. In the absence of the right superior vena cava (RSVC), implantation of a right ventricular pacing lead may be challenging. Therefore specific implantation techniques and experiences in PLSVC are worth reporting. CASE PRESENTATION We present a case report of a 90-year-old Caucasian female patient with PLSVC during single chamber pacemaker implantation due to the third-degree atrioventricular block. With common implantation techniques, we did not even reach the right ventricle. Therefore slittable CPS Direct ™ Universal sheath was employed to overcome the acute angle from PLSVC to tricuspid valve and ensure more fixation stability for longer 100-cm right ventricular lead placement. CONCLUSION This case demonstrates safe implantation of 100-cm long right ventricular bipolar active fixation pacing lead using common slittable CPS Direct ™ Universal sheath after failed attempts with "C" and "J" stylet shaped electrode. This sheath provides different angle towards tricuspid valve and more fixation stability in patient with PLSVC and absent connection to right atrium.

Abstract
A persistent left superior vena cava (PLSVC) is the most frequent anomaly of the venous drainage system. While both a right and left superior vena cava (SVC) are usually present, a unique, left-sided SVC, also known as an isolated PLSVC, accounts for only 10–20% of cases. It is frequently associated with arrhythmias and other congenital cardiac anomalies. Though it is usually an asymptomatic condition, it may pose significant problems whenever central venous access is needed. We report a case of an isolated PLSVC that was diagnosed incidentally during pacemaker implantation for sinus node dysfunction. The venous anomaly was associated with subvalvular aortic stenosis determined by a subaortic membrane; this particular association of congenital cardiovascular anomalies is a rare finding, with only a few cases reported in the literature. We aim to highlight the clinical and practical implications of this condition, as well as to discuss the embryonic development and diagnostic methods of this congenital defect.

Abstract
BACKGROUND There are limited data on cardiac implantable electronic device implantation (CIED) in patients with persistent left superior vena cava (PLSVC). OBJECTIVE To describe the outcomes of implanting CIEDs with a focus on cardiac resynchronization therapy (CRT) in patients with PLSVC. METHODS We identified all patients with a PLSVC that underwent CIED implantation from December 2008 until February 2019 at our institution by querying the electronic medical record (n = 34). We then identified controls in a 3:1 fashion (n = 102) by matching on device type (CRT vs non-CRT). Procedure success, complications, fluoroscopy and procedural time were recorded. Outcomes were compared using a two-way analysis of variance test and conditional regression modeling for continuous and categorical variables, respectively. RESULTS A total of 34 patients with PLSVC underwent 38 procedures. Four patients underwent dual chamber system implantation followed by a subsequent upgrade to CRT. Thirteen patients underwent CRT implantation: one was implanted via the right subclavian while the rest were implanted via the PLSVC. Left ventricular (P = .06). Procedure and fluoroscopy times were significantly higher in the PLSVC as compared with the control group (97.7 vs 66.1 minute, P < .001 and 18.1 minute vs 8.7 minutes, P = .005, respectively). CONCLUSION CIED implant in patients with PLSVC is feasible but technically more challenging and appears to be associated with higher risk of right ventricular lead dislodgment.
